Our process
A Smooth and Reliable Process Keeps Tenants and Owners Happy
Most tree work is pretty straightforward. You’re concerned about a tree. I come look. We figure out what it needs. Then, we do the work. Here’s what that actually looks like:
You Contact Us
Send the tenant report or owner request. We’ll schedule a site visit within a few days.
We Assess and Send Your Bid
We look at the tree, talk to the tenant if needed, and email you a detailed estimate. Usually within 48 hours.
You Get Approval
Forward our bid to the owner. Our pricing is fair and clear, so approvals typically come quick.
We Coordinate with the Tenant
We call the tenant directly to schedule. We confirm timing, explain what we’ll be doing, and answer their questions.
We Do the Work
Skilled removal or pruning. Hand tools for fine work. Safe rigging. Everything done right.
We Clean Up Completely
Debris hauled, branches chipped on request, yard raked. We’re a little OCD about this part.
Job Done, Everyone’s Happy
We update you when it’s complete. Tenant’s satisfied. Owner’s satisfied. Your phone stays quiet.

When Removal is the Right Call: A Declining Elm in Grants Pass
A diseased elm dropped a large branch near a Grants Pass home, threatening both the property and neighbors. The tree was beautiful, but in decline. See why removal was the safest call and how we took it down without the outbuilding or fence.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do you handle tenant coordination?
We call the tenant directly to schedule. We let them know when we’re coming, what we’ll be doing, and how long it’ll take. Then we show up on time and follow up when we’re done. You stay in the loop through email updates, but you don’t have to play phone tag between us and the tenant.
How fast can I get a bid?
Usually within 48-72 hours. We know you’re juggling multiple properties and owners are waiting. We prioritize emergency requests because we understand timing matters. After we visit the site, we’ll email you a detailed estimate with a breakdown of what needs doing and why.
Do I need owner approval before you start work?
Yes. We provide a clear, itemized bid that you can forward to the owner. Our pricing is fair and honest, so approvals typically come through without much back-and-forth. Once the owner gives you the green light, we move forward.
What if the tree doesn’t actually need work?
We’ll tell you. If an owner asks us to “look at everything” and the trees are fine, we say so. We’d rather keep the long-term relationship than push unnecessary work. The assessment is always free, so there’s no cost even if we recommend doing nothing.
What about cleanup? Tenants always complain about that.
We’re a little OCD about cleanup. Debris gets hauled away, branches get chipped on request, and the yard gets raked. We leave it cleaner than we found it. That’s why property managers tell us they’ve never gotten a single complaint after we leave.
Can you handle multiple properties for us?
Absolutely. Many of our property manager clients send us to different properties throughout the year. We keep track of each location and prioritize your requests. Whether it’s one tree or ten properties, we handle it with the same care and integrity.
Do you offer emergency tree services?
Yes. If a storm drops a branch on a roof or a tree comes down after heavy wind, we respond as quickly as possible. Call us and we’ll get there to assess the damage and make the site safe. We handle both planned removals and emergency calls.
